Abstract :
This study conducts failure analysis of filament wound glass reinforced plastic (GRP) pipes made of E-glass/epoxy with an inclined surface crack under open-ended internal pressure. Test specimens are composed of six antisymmetric layers with (±55°)3 winding angles. Tests have been performed at seven different crack angles: View the MathML source0°,15°,30°,60°,45°,75°, and 90°90°, with crack-to-thickness ratio of a/t=0.50a/t=0.50. The burst strengths of the specimens were determined, and the dependence of the burst strength on the crack angle was examined.
